首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我收到错误“未找到与请求URI匹配的HTTP资源”

这个错误提示通常表示在发送HTTP请求时,服务器无法找到与请求的URI(统一资源标识符)匹配的资源。这可能是由于以下几个原因导致的:

  1. URI错误:请确保请求的URI正确无误,包括路径、文件名和查询参数等。可以通过检查拼写错误、路径错误或缺少必要的查询参数来解决此问题。
  2. 资源不存在:服务器可能无法找到请求的资源。请确保所请求的资源存在于服务器上,并且路径正确。如果资源被移动或删除,您需要更新URI以反映新的位置。
  3. 权限问题:如果请求的资源需要特定的权限才能访问,而您没有提供正确的凭据或权限,则会收到此错误。请确保您具有访问所请求资源的必要权限。
  4. 服务器配置问题:此错误可能是由于服务器配置错误导致的。检查服务器配置文件,确保正确地映射URI到相应的资源。

对于这个错误,腾讯云提供了一系列的解决方案和产品,以下是一些相关的产品和链接:

  1. 腾讯云CDN(内容分发网络):通过将静态资源缓存到全球分布的边缘节点,加速内容传输,提高访问速度和稳定性。了解更多:腾讯云CDN
  2. 腾讯云API网关:提供统一的API入口,帮助您管理和发布API,并提供高性能、高可用的API访问服务。了解更多:腾讯云API网关
  3. 腾讯云负载均衡:将流量分发到多个后端服务器,提高系统的可用性和性能。了解更多:腾讯云负载均衡
  4. 腾讯云云服务器(CVM):提供可扩展的云服务器实例,满足不同规模和需求的应用程序。了解更多:腾讯云云服务器

请注意,以上仅是腾讯云提供的一些解决方案和产品示例,其他云计算品牌商也提供类似的产品和解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 爬虫 NO.4 HTTP 响应状态码

HTTP 响应状态码 响应状态码,即 Response Status Code,表示服务器响应状态,如 200 代表服务器正常响应,404 代表页面未找到,500 代表服务器内部发生错误。...常见 HTTP 状态码 200 - 请求成功 301 - 资源(网页等)被永久转移到其它URL 404 - 请求资源(网页等)不存在 500 - 内部服务器错误 3....今后任何新请求都应使用新URI代替 302 临时移动 301类似。但资源只是临时被移动。客户端应继续使用原有URI 303 查看其它地址 301类似。...客户端通常会缓存访问过资源,通过提供一个头信息指出客户端希望只返回在指定日期之后修改资源 305 使用代理 所请求资源必须通过代理访问 306 已经被废弃HTTP状态码 307 临时重定向 ...使用GET请求重定向 400 错误请求 服务器无法解析该请求 401 未授权 请求没有进行身份验证或验证未通过 402 保留,将来使用 403 禁止访问 服务器拒绝此请求 404 未找到 服务器无法根据客户端请求找到资源

1.2K10

HTTP 响应状态码全解

HTTP 状态代码或响应码共分为五类,分别是 1×× 提示信息,2×× 成功,3×× 重定向,4×× 客户端错误,5×× 服务器错误。 本文包含了完整 HTTP 状态码以及相应描述信息。...301-永久移动,状态代码指示目标资源已分配了一个新永久 URI,并且将来对该资源任何引用都应使用其中一个封闭 URI。 302-找到,状态代码指示目标资源暂时驻留在不同 uri 下。...404 未找到 404(未找到)状态代码指示源服务器没有找到目标资源的当前表示,或者不愿意公开存在表示。...请求范围不满足 417 预期失败 418 是个茶壶,超文本咖啡罐控制协议,但是并没有被实际HTTP服务器实现 421 错误请求 422 不可处理实体 423 锁定 424 失败依赖关系 426...502 坏网关 502(坏网关)状态代码表示服务器在充当网关或代理时,在尝试完成请求时从其访问入站服务器接收到无效响应。

2.7K30

Nginx - URL微妙差异:Nginx斜杠魔法

请求URI传递到服务器方式如下: 如果proxy_pass指令带有URI,当请求传递到服务器时,匹配location标准化请求URI部分将被指令中指定URI替换: location /name/...proxy_pass指令基本用法:定义代理服务器协议和地址,并可选择指定URI。当指定URI时,请求匹配部分会被替换;未指定URI时,原始请求保持不变。...rewrite指令配合:在使用rewrite更改URI时,proxy_pass忽略指定URI,使用修改后完整URI。...测试路径移除:发送请求到前端 /api/test,检查后端是否接收到 http://backend/test。 测试工具 可以使用以下工具进行测试: cURL:命令行工具,用于发送 HTTP 请求。...404 错误请求未找到,检查路径是否正确。 502 错误:后端服务器未响应,检查后端服务器状态。 2.

6100

HTTP1.1协议状态码

阅读建议 篇幅较长,建议收藏,可以当做手册来查询使用 善用目录索引,快速定位你想知道状态码 点赞、关注、收藏,一键三连支持(抱拳) 从此妈妈再也不用担心 http 状态码问题了。...注意:在之后自动重定向POST请求收到301状态代码,一些现有的HTTP / 1.0用户代理 会错误地将其更改为GET请求。...诠释: 不想让你访问资源, 比如你在做爬虫程序, 在爬取同一个网络资源时, 对应站点就可以给你返回 403 来禁止你资源请求. ---- 404 Not Found 服务器未找到请求URI匹配任何内容...可以认为这种情况是永久。具有链接编辑功能客户端应在用户批准后删除对Request-URI引用。如果服务器不知道或没有确定条件是否为永久性条件,则应改用状态代码404(未找到)。...---- 504 Gateway Timeout 该服务器虽然充当网关或代理,但没有收到来自URI指定上游服务器(例如HTTP,FTP,LDAP)或尝试完成访问所需访问某些其他辅助服务器及时响应。

2.6K40

HTTP状态码

500~505 服务器错误 状态码 状态码 原因短语 含义 100 Continue(继续) 收到请求起始部分,客户端应该继续请求 101 Switching Protocols(切换协议) 服务器正根据客户端指示将协议切换成...但客户端应该用Location首部给出 URL 对资源进行临时定位 400 Bad request(坏请求) 告诉客户端它发送了一条异常请求 401 Unauthorized(未授权) 适当首部一起返回...Not Found(未找到) 服务器无法找到所请求 URL 405 Method Not Allowed(不允许使用方法) 请求中有一个所请求 URI 不支持方法。...服务器没有资源客户端可接受 URL 相匹配时可使用此代码 407 Proxy Authentication Required( 要求进行代理认证) 和状态码 401 类似,但用于需要进行资源认证代理服务器...505 HTTP Version Not Supported(不支持 HTTP 版本) 服务器收到请求是以它不支持或不愿支持协议版本表示

1K10

网络编程之HTTP状态码详解

400~417 客户端错误 500~599 500~505 服务器错误 二、状态码详细说明 100~199(已定义:100~101) 状态码 原因短语 含义 100 Continue( 继续) 收到请求起始部分...403 Forbidden( 禁止) 服务器拒绝了请求 404 Not Found( 未找到) 服务器无法找到所请求 URL 405 Method Not Allowed( 不允许使用方法) 请求中有一个所请求...服务器没有资源客户端可接受 URL 相匹配时可使用此代码 407 Proxy Authentication Required( 要求进行代理认证) 和状态码 401 类似, 但用于需要进行资源认证代理服务器...Gateway Timeout( 网关超时) 状态码 408 类似, 但是响应来自网关或代理, 此网关或代理在等待另一台服务器响应时出现了超时 505 HTTP Version Not Supported...( 不支持 HTTP 版本) 服务器收到请求是以它不支持或不愿支持协议版本表示

75140

HTTP协议之状态码详解

HTTP状态码,都是现查现用。 以前记得几个常用状态码,比如200,302,304,404, 503。 一般来说也只需要了解这些常用状态码就可以了。 ...Response中应该包含一个Location URL, 说明资源现在所处位置 304 Not Modified(未修改)客户缓存资源是最新, 要客户端使用缓存 404 Not Found 未找到资源...403 Forbidden(禁止) 请求被服务器拒绝了 状态码403 404 Not Found(未找到未找到资源 HTTP协议详解-404 405 Method Not Allowed(不允许使用方法...Not Supported(不支持HTTP版本) 服务器收到请求使用了它不支持HTTP协议版本。...414 Request URI Too Long(请求URI太长)   就是说Request URI太长, 一般浏览器本身对URI长度就会有限制,所以不会发送URI很长Request.

1.4K10

知识分享之规范——HTTP 状态码

知识分享之规范——HTTP 状态码 背景 知识分享之规范类别是进行整理日常开发使用各类规范说明,作为一个程序员需要天天和各种各样规范打交道,而有些规范可能我们并不是特别了解,为此将一些常见规范均整理到知识分享之规范系列中...102 处理 (WebDAV) 表示服务器已收到并正在处理请求,但还没有响应。 103 早期提示 主要用于Link标头一起使用。它建议用户代理在服务器准备最终响应时开始预加载资源。...307临时重定向 指示客户端使用先前请求中使用相同方法从另一个 URI 获取请求资源。它与302 Found之前请求中使用相同 HTTP 方法类似,但有一个例外。... 401 不同,客户端身份为服务器所知。 404 未找到 服务器找不到请求资源。 405 方法不允许 服务器知道请求 HTTP 方法,但已被禁用,不能用于该资源。...408 请求超时 表示服务器在服务器分配超时期限内没有收到来自客户端完整请求。 409 冲突 由于资源的当前状态冲突,无法完成请求。 410 走了 请求资源在服务器上不再可用。

1.7K30

喵星人教你 HTTP 状态码

在我们日常 Web 开发中,或多或少都接触过 HTTP 状态码,那这些状态码代表什么意思呢?熟悉这些状态码又有什么好处呢?下面就为大家一一道来,可以把本片文章‘收藏’以备不时之需。...请求资源临时从不同 URI 响应请求。由于这样重定向是临时,客户端应当继续向原有地址发送以后请求。...请求要求身份验证。对于需要登录网页,服务器可能返回此响应。 403 Forbidden(禁止) ? 服务器拒绝请求。 404 Not Found(未找到) ? 服务器找不到请求资源。...414 Request-URI Too Long(请求 URI 过长) ? 请求 URI(通常为网址)过长,服务器无法处理。...文中图片整理自 https://http.cat/,内容整理自“维基百科 HTTP 状态码” 最后 欢迎留言写出你家喵星人品种和你对他“爱称”,很好奇有没有给自己家猫起名叫 “404” 小伙伴

65020

HTTP 状态码类型描述

二、HTTP 状态码分类 1xx 信息,服务器收到请求,需要请求者继续执行操作。 2xx 成功,操作被成功接收并处理。 3xx 重定向,需要进一步操作以完成请求。...2xx 成功 200 OK/正常 请求已成功,请求内容将同时返回。 201 已创建 请求已实现,已根据请求创建了新资源,将同时返回资源URI。 202 接受 请求已接受,服务器正在处理。...305 使用代理 HTTP 1.1 新增状态码。被请求资源必须通过指定代理访问。 307 临时重定向 HTTP 1.1 新增状态码。被请求资源可在另一位置找到,并应采用 POST 方式访问。...404 未找到 客户端所请求资源未找到。 5xx 服务器错误 500 内部服务器错误 服务器遇到未知错误导致请求无法完成。 501 未实现 服务器不支持客户端请求功能。...502 网关错误 网关或代理服务器接收到远端服务器无效响应。 503 服务无法获得 服务器已超载或维护中导致请求无法完成。 504 网关超时 HTTP 1.1 新增状态码。

48631

常见web网站访问错误代码 |怎么又404了!!!

那么这些web错误访问代码具体到底是什么意思呢?花时间整理了一下每个web网站访问错误代码含义,希望对大家有用。 1xx(临时响应): 表示临时响应并需要请求者继续执行操作状态码。...403(禁止)服务器拒绝请求。 404(未找到)服务器找不到请求网页。例如,对于服务器上不存在网页经常会返回此代码。 405(方法禁用)禁用请求中指定方法。...406(不接受)无法使用请求内容特性响应请求网页。 407(需要代理授权)此状态码 401(未授权)类似,但指定请求者应当授权使用代理。如果服务器返回此响应,还表示请求者应当使用代理。...413(请求实体过大)服务器无法处理请求,因为请求实体过大,超出服务器处理能力。 414(请求 URI 过长)请求 URI(通常为网址)过长,服务器无法处理。...504(网关超时)服务器作为网关或代理,但是没有及时从上游服务器收到请求。 505(HTTP 版本不受支持)服务器不支持请求中所用 HTTP 协议版本。

2.3K20

常见web网站访问错误代码 | 卧槽,怎么又404了!!!

那么这些web错误访问代码具体到底是什么意思呢?花时间整理了一下每个web网站访问错误代码含义,希望对大家有用。 1xx(临时响应): 表示临时响应并需要请求者继续执行操作状态码。...403(禁止)服务器拒绝请求。 404(未找到)服务器找不到请求网页。例如,对于服务器上不存在网页经常会返回此代码。 405(方法禁用)禁用请求中指定方法。...406(不接受)无法使用请求内容特性响应请求网页。 407(需要代理授权)此状态码 401(未授权)类似,但指定请求者应当授权使用代理。如果服务器返回此响应,还表示请求者应当使用代理。...413(请求实体过大)服务器无法处理请求,因为请求实体过大,超出服务器处理能力。 414(请求 URI 过长)请求 URI(通常为网址)过长,服务器无法处理。...504(网关超时)服务器作为网关或代理,但是没有及时从上游服务器收到请求。 505(HTTP 版本不受支持)服务器不支持请求中所用 HTTP 协议版本。 ----

1.3K30

学习提升之HTTP状态码详解

404 Not Found(未找到未找到资源 405 Method Not Allowed(不允许使用方法) 不支持该Request方法。...(不支持HTTP版本) 服务器收到请求使用了它不支持HTTP协议版本。...该状态码表示请求资源已经被分配了新URI,并且以后使用资源现在所指URI。并且根据请求方法有不同处理方式: HEAD:必须在响应头部Location字段中指明新永久性URI。...Other 该状态码表示由于请求对应资源存在另一个URI,应使用GET方法定向获取请求资源。...我们平常是根本看不到414错误。 但是机器人可以发送很长URI。 3.21 500 Internal Server Error(内部服务器错误) 该状态码表明服务器端在执行请求时发生了错误

1.2K60

http状态码

该代码 404(未找到)代码相似,但在资源以前存在而现在不存在情况下,有时会用来替代 404 代码。如果资源已永久删除,您应当使用 301 指定资源新位置。...502(错误网关) 服务器作为网关或代理,从上游服务器收到了无效响应。 503(服务不可用) 目前无法使用服务器(由于超载或进行停机维护)。通常,这只是一种暂时状态。...常见HTTP相应状态码 200:请求被正常处理 204:请求被受理但没有资源可以返回 206:客户端只是请求资源一部分,服务器只对请求部分资源执行GET方法,相应报文中通过Content-Range...301:永久性重定向 302:临时重定向 303:302状态码有相似功能,只是它希望客户端在请求一个URI时候,能通过GET方法重定向到另一个URI上 304:发送附带条件请求时,条件不满足时返回...,重定向无关 307:临时重定向,302类似,只是强制要求使用POST方法 400:请求报文语法有误,服务器无法识别 401:请求需要认证 403:请求对应资源禁止被访问 404:服务器无法找到对应资源

1.3K30

Asp.Net Web API(三)

当Web API接收到一个请求时候,它将这个请求路由到一个Action。         注意:Web API路由Asp.Net MVC路由是非常相似的。...当Web API框架接收到一个HTTP请求时,它会试图根据路由表中一个路由模板来匹配URI。如果无路由匹配,客户端会接收到一个404(未找到错误。...因为如果不注释 Web API会匹配请求匹配多个操作错误 ?...而且,它会排除特殊名称方法(构造器,事件,操作符,重载符等),以及集成自ApiController类方法 HTTP Methods     Web API框架只会选择请求HTTP方法匹配Action...在这种背景下,Action选择算法如下 创建该控制器中HTTP请求方法匹配所有Action列表 如果路由字典有Action条目,移除该条目值不匹配Action 试图将Action参数URI

1.7K50

RFC2616-HTTP1.1-Status Code(状态码规定部分—译文)

在响应中返回信息取决于在请求中使用方法,例如:   GET  请求资源相一致实体会在响应中返回;   HEAD 请求资源相一致实体头字段会在响应中返回,响应返回内容没有任何消息体(message-body...如果该响应中存在Content-Length头字段,它值必须信息体中传输八位字节数值相匹配。...10.3.1 300 多种选择(Multiple Choices)   所请求资源代理资源集合中任何一个都匹配,每一个都有其指定地址,并且提供了代理驱动(agent-driven)相关协商信息...Note:当收到301状态码后自动重定向POST请求时,一些现有的HTTP/1.0用户代理将错误地将其更改为GET请求。...10.4.5 404 未找到(Not Found)   服务器在匹配请求URI上没有找到任何东西。没有迹象表明这种情况是暂时还是永久

91820
领券